Sometimes we have to find ways to motivate our children. Perhaps to develop new habits or change old ones. Andrew really struggles getting to school on time. He likes to take his own sweet time and at his own pace not matter how much I remind him that "You need to hurry, you're going to be late!!!" Well, he got a letter from the principal that he had too many tardies and needed to try harder to be on time. You would think this would motivate him, but only slightly... then I had a grand idea! When his exercise ball popped, he wanted to get a new one so bad. Mmmmm, perfect opportunity/motivation... how about no exercise ball until he is consistently on time to school... Ah ha, great idea! It worked brilliantly! I have never seen him so motivated and moving so quickly in the morning, it was awesome!! After 2 weeks he got his ball, and now his consequence for being late...the ball is taken away for an extended period of time, until he proves that he is still "motivated" to be on time... still working like a charm!
